Is De'Aaron Fox Clutch?
In the 2022-23 season, Fox proved that he is indeed clutch. He led the league in clutch points, which are defined as points scored in the final five minutes of a game with the point differential within five points. Fox scored a total of 131 clutch points throughout the season, which is more than any other player in the league.
Fox's clutch performance was not limited to just scoring points. He also showed that he can make crucial plays in the clutch moments of the game, such as making a steal or an assist that can turn the tide of the game. These clutch plays were crucial for the Kings, who had a mixed season overall but showed a lot of promise for the future.
As a result of his outstanding performance, Fox was awarded the inaugural NBA Clutch Player of the Year Award. This award recognizes players who have shown exceptional performance in clutch situations throughout the season. Fox's win was well-deserved and cemented his place as one of the most clutch players in the league.
